I scheduled an appointmnent for my dog ( a 1year old pure bred collie) for a shampoo and brushing at 1:00pm. When I dropped her off, I was told it could be 4-5 hours until she was done. I then gave my contact #, and dropped my dog off. I checked back at 4:00pm just to see when she'd be ready, I was told it would be another 2 hours.
I left and went home. At 4:57pm I was called on a message telephone # (which is not the # I gave them to contact me) a message was left to call them, I didn't get the message until 5:30pm, because I rarely check that phone. I called and was told my dog had received an injury while being bathed. She hit her face on a metal rack above the tub when the dryer was turned on an received 2 gashes in her cheeck under her eye. I was very upset that she was not taken to the vet right away, I granted permission for them to seek medical attention if needed by signing a form when I checked her in. I was only called ONCE (on the wrong #) and then while Petco waited for me to respond my dog was injured, cold and wet in a cage. I am very angry as to the way the situation was handled.
Furthermore when I got there to pick her up, the girl that had been bathing her acknowledged I was there, but continued to help a lady with last minuite clippings of her dogs fur, for about 5 minutes, then answered the phone and took a personal phone call!!! Hello, my dog needs stitches and is wet, scared and in a cage, could she have been any more unprofessional!? And she did not apologize.
The manager did speak to me and explained what happened, he also admitted he did not want to take my dog to the vet because he thought I would "freak-out", I would have been more at ease knowing she was in good hands with a vet, than sitting in a cage.
I felt very sad that there are probably more dogs being neglected, and treated bad by groomers who aren't qualified to handle an urgent situation.
Petco did pay for the vet bill of about $800.00, I am greatful for that, however their staff needs better trainning, and some type of medical trainning to handle the urgency.
